Cassens Transport is an automotive logistics company focusing on serving domestic and international automobile manufacturers and dealers. Founded in 1936, it is headquartered in Edwardsville, Illinois, with terminals in multiple locations across the United States and Canada. As a subsidiary of Cassens Corporation, Cassens Transport operates in the automotive logistics services industry, providing support to automobile stakeholders.
The company has diverse employee demographics, with 13% female and 29.9% ethnic minorities. Although there is a noticeable lack of political diversity among the staff, Cassens Transport boasts excellent employee retention, with staff members typically staying with the company for 6.3 years. Currently led by CEO Lisa Shashek, this large automotive company employs approximately 3,000 workers and generates an annual revenue of $330 million.
